Where to Find Royalty and Copyright Free Music for Content Creators

woman listening on headphones

Content creators are always looking for a way to snazz up their video content or spice up their podcast. Fortunately, it’s a fairly inexpensive thing to do to find royalty free and copyright free music for content creators. Here are both free and paid options to find tracks and sound effects to enhance your content creation.

Audio Library

Completely free is always good, and Audio Library has plenty of royalty-free music for content creators to use. They have a wide array of musical styles to choose from.

EDM Royalty Free

This website offers curated creative commons music for absolutely free as long as it’s purely for personal use. You can then pay for licensing if you’re using it for commercial purposes. There’s also the option to support their Patreon for unlimited music for just $3/month (until they reach 100 patrons which as of 7/15/20 they have not).

Thematic

While it’s only for its public beta period, Thematic is currently FREE. They offer pre-cleared, curated royalty-free music for content creators. If you try it out, let us know what you think!

Epidemic Sounds

While it’s not free, a personal subscription costs only $15/month and a pro subscription costs $50/mo; plus, it’s significantly less if you pay for a yearly subscription. Epidemic Sounds is used by over 100,000 content creators. It offers over 32,000 tracks and over 64,000 sound effects. If you’re just using the music or effects for your personal YouTube channel, it’s well worth the investment.

EvokeMusic AI

EvokeMusic is an AI-generated royalty-free music site. Obviously, there is no copyright on this music, since it’s computer generated. All you have to do is provide keywords to the AI and it will mix something up for you. Subscriptions are pretty cheap, especially for your own personal content creation needs.
